Farewell Tribute to Singer Ramakrishna Dhakal at Sydney’s Flavors of Nepal Restaurant

Sydney — A special farewell program in honor of renowned singer Ram Krishna Dhakal was held on Tuesday at Flavors of Nepal restaurant in Granville, Sydney. After completing his musical performances in various cities across Australia, this farewell program was organized as the final event, where singer Dhakal was presented with a traditional khada scarf and a certificate of appreciation.

The event, organized by restaurant owner Rajesh KC and journalist Rajan Ghimire, saw singer Dhakal expressing his gratitude for the love and support he received from the Nepali audience in Australia throughout his musical journey. Amid a large crowd of attendees, he performed some of his popular songs. Notably, songs like “Orali Lagako Harinko Chal Bho” and “Ae Maya Jadaun” filled the atmosphere with music. He also performed immortal songs by singer Narayan Gopal, further enhancing the audience’s enjoyment.

Flavors of Nepal restaurant is known for welcoming and honoring Nepali artists. In the past, artists like singer Badri Pangeni, Sindhu Malla, and many others have been honored here. Singer Dhakal mentioned that the love and support from the Australian audience has inspired him to return again. “Seeing the immense love from the audience makes me want to come back again,” Dhakal said.

One of the attendees described Flavors of Nepal as a prime destination in Sydney for those who want to savor Nepali cuisine.

After completing his musical tour of Australia, singer Dhakal is now preparing to perform in various cities in the United States.
